A patent using Cobalt Chloride - COCL2 + any material containing Co element to strengthen and repair bone damage of all ages groups from children to the aged which may contain stem, osteogenic, chrondrogenic cells with non protein organic material i.e. polymers,hydogels, rubbers , also inorganic materials such as ceramics,silicon ,gels, iron, steel, titanium, aluminium , brass and applied to bone defect areas and may also be used in food and drink products to enhance bone structure and strength
